Sensitive Data Guide Teachprivacy What is an example of sensitive data? some examples of sensitive data include your health records, religious beliefs, biometric data (such as fingerprints), and political opinions. even details about your sex life or union membership count, since someone could use them to profile you or discriminate against you. Sensitive data—also known as special category data or sensitive personal data—is confidential information that you should only make available to people who have the right permissions to access it.
